A true artist knows that anything can be turned into a canvas — even a slice of bread. Well, not all artists can harness bread’s creative powers, but one Japanese baker has done just that. She creates amazing “paintings,” only visible after you slice the loaf of bread and peer inside. This creative kitchen creator posts her work on Instagram under the name @konel_bread, and on each post she explains (mostly in Japanese) about her inspiration. Apparently, some of that inspo is derived from the creation of sushi rolls, an art in-and-of-itself that Japan both created and mastered. So how does she do it? Baking at home, she has her son film her efforts, separating out rolls of colored dough and arranging them into tubes. Those tubes bake together, and when you cut open the bread, voila!
